3. The S Bridge: A Historic Marvel

Next on the itinerary is a visit to one of the few remaining "S" bridges in the United States. Located in Southview, Pennsylvania, this architectural marvel is a testament to the ingenuity and craftsmanship of a bygone era. The curved design of the bridge, resembling the letter "S," allowed wagons and carriages to navigate the surrounding hills with ease. Take a moment to marvel at the construction and appreciate the bridge's historical significance. It's a must-see for architecture enthusiasts and anyone looking to be captivated by the region's rich heritage.

5. LeMoyne House: Stepping into the Past

Our final stop takes you to the historic LeMoyne House in Washington, Pennsylvania. This meticulously restored residence offers a fascinating glimpse into the life of Dr. Francis Julius LeMoyne, a leading abolitionist and advocate for women's rights in the 19th century. Immerse yourself in the history as you explore the museum's exhibits, including artifacts from the Underground Railroad and the women's suffrage movement. This hidden gem is a testament to the power of one individual's dedication to justice and equality.
